3840x5760 32950f48d9b9de29c940d0b9b0979122641cc8a478fcb671

3840x5760 32950f48d9b9de29c940d0b9b0979122641cc8a478fcb671

21 views

3840 × 5760 — JPEG 1.7 MB

Uploaded 7 months ago

No description provided.